C++冷门知识点1

news/2024/9/29 1:11:01/

1.特殊情况汇总:

负数,空指针,叶节点,INT_MAX和INT_MIN

2.双指针法(快慢指针,头尾指针),三数指针法(链表逆序那块)

3.一定要注意极端情况

2.e后边可以跟负数但是不能跟小数

3.string的push_back不能直接插入整形

参数是97的话,插入的是a

这样的话即插入字符b

4.vector<bool>类型的变量在resize后默认新的就是全0 (测试环境:VS2022)

5.

10.INT_MIN的补码是10000000 00000000 00000000 00000000

原码取反加一会溢出

11.

13.

即说明是单向链表

14.

15.数组作为函数进行传递时,数组就会自动退化成同类型的指针(尽管形参是数组的形式)

17.cout打印浮点数时,不会打印小数点后边的0,会出现后边没有小数点的情况

18.

那是-2的补码


http://www.ppmy.cn/news/1531180.html

相关文章

【devops】devops-ansible模块介绍

本站以分享各种运维经验和运维所需要的技能为主 《python零基础入门》&#xff1a;python零基础入门学习 《python运维脚本》&#xff1a; python运维脚本实践 《shell》&#xff1a;shell学习 《terraform》持续更新中&#xff1a;terraform_Aws学习零基础入门到最佳实战 《k8…

探索未来科技的无限可能:IT领域的深度剖析与前瞻

探索未来科技的无限可能&#xff1a;IT领域的深度剖析与前瞻 在这个日新月异的时代&#xff0c;信息技术&#xff08;IT&#xff09;如同一股不可阻挡的洪流&#xff0c;深刻地改变着我们的生活方式、工作模式乃至整个社会的运行逻辑。今天&#xff0c;让我们一同潜入IT的浩瀚…

泛型(Java)

1.泛型&#xff1a; 将数据类型作为参数进行传递。(传递的数据类型必须是引用数据类型) 本质是参数化类型。 泛型集合&#xff1a;可以约束集合内的元素类型 典型泛型集合ArrayList<E>、HashMap<K,V> <E>、<K,V>表示该泛型集合中的元素类型泛型集合中的…

Tableau|一入门

一 什么是BI工具 BI 工具即商业智能&#xff08;Business Intelligence&#xff09;工具&#xff0c;是一种用于收集、整理、分析和展示企业数据的软件系统&#xff0c;其主要目的是帮助企业用户更好地理解和利用数据&#xff0c;以支持决策制定。 主要功能&#xff1a; 1.数据…

NLP-transformer学习:(7)evaluate实践

NLP-transformer学习&#xff1a;&#xff08;7&#xff09;evaluate 使用方法 打好基础&#xff0c;为了后面学习走得更远。 本章节是单独的 NLP-transformer学习 章节&#xff0c;主要实践了evaluate。同时&#xff0c;最近将学习代码传到&#xff1a;https://github.com/Mex…

人工智能助力阿尔茨海默症治疗:微软与上海精神卫生中心的新研究

最近&#xff0c;微软研究院与上海市精神卫生中心合作&#xff0c;基于微软 Azure OpenAI 服务中的多模态大模型&#xff0c;开发了一种名为“忆我”&#xff08;ReMe&#xff09;的个性化认知训练框架。这一创新项目旨在通过数字化手段扩展自动化认知训练的范围&#xff0c;为…

网络原理 - TCP/IP

文章目录 传输层UDP协议TCP协议TCP协议的核心机制确认应答机制超时重传机制连接管理三次握手四次挥手 滑动窗口流量控制拥塞控制延迟应答捎带应答面向字节流粘包问题 异常情况 小结 网络层IP协议IP地址不够用的问题一、动态分配IP地址二、 NAT机制(网络地址映射)三、使用IPv6 地…

智能工牌如何通过自然语义处理技术帮助企业提高业务复盘效率?

在数字化转型的大潮中&#xff0c;企业不断寻求新的工具和技术来优化运营流程、提升工作效率。智能工牌作为一种新兴的技术解决方案&#xff0c;正在逐渐改变企业的管理方式&#xff0c;特别是在销售和服务领域。本文将探讨智能工牌如何利用自然语义理解技术来帮助企业提高业务…